Nikon's 12-24 (18-36 mm equivalent) or Tokina's 11-16 (16.5-24 mm equivalent)
how do u get the equivalent?
Because the APS-C size sensor in Nikon DSLRs save for the D700 and D1/D2/D3 has a 1.5x crop. Thus, a 50 mm lens on a film DSLR "becomes a" 75 mm version on the DSLRs...
